Mastery of Swift and Objective-C #

A robust understanding of both Swift and Objective-C is imperative. Swift, with its modern syntax and safety features, is the go-to language for developing contemporary iOS apps. However, proficiency in Objective-C remains valuable, particularly when working with legacy code or integrating with long-standing frameworks. A developer who seamlessly navigates between both languages can adapt to any project requirement and ensure a smooth development process.

Expertise in iOS SDK and Frameworks #

An adept iOS developer must be completely comfortable with the iOS SDK and its surrounding frameworks. This includes a strong grasp of key tools such as Xcode, UIKit, Core Data, and newer APIs that enhance user experience. Familiarity with these frameworks not only accelerates development but also ensures that applications are built to meet the high standards expected in today’s competitive market. This expertise is essential whether you’re building a sleek consumer app or a robust enterprise solution.

Debugging, Optimization, and Code Quality #

Writing code is just the beginning; maintaining code quality and ensuring optimal performance are equally important. A top-tier iOS developer should excel in debugging and optimization practices. This encompasses the ability to swiftly identify and resolve issues, streamline performance for smoother user interactions, and adhere to best practices in code quality. With these skills, developers can minimize downtime, enhance app stability, and ultimately deliver a more polished end product.

Interview Strategies for iOS Developers #

The interview phase is crucial for understanding the candidate's technical expertise and their approach to problem-solving. Here are some strategies to consider:

  • Behavioral Questions: Ask about past experiences with challenges unique to iOS development. For example, inquire how they've managed app performance issues or navigated UI/UX hurdles specific to Apple's ecosystem.
  • Technical Deep-Dive: Explore their knowledge of Swift, Objective-C, and an understanding of iOS frameworks. Request examples of projects they've completed, discussing both the successes and the lessons learned.
  • Cultural Fit and Communication: Assess how well they might integrate with your team. Topics like their approach to peer code reviews, adaptability to feedback, and collaboration in fast-moving project environments are essential. This ensures that when you hire an iPhone developer, you're also selecting someone who enhances your team's dynamic.

Using a combination of these strategies will allow you to gauge both the hard and soft skills of your candidates, ultimately streamlining your selection process and ensuring a better fit for your long-term project needs.

Practical Coding Tests and Assessments #

Beyond interviews, practical tests are invaluable for confirming a candidate’s technical capabilities. Here’s how you can effectively implement these assessments:

  • Real-World Scenarios: Design coding tests that mirror the challenges they will face on the job. Whether it's optimizing a user interface for performance or debugging an existing issue, the task should reflect true-to-life problems.
  • Time-Bound Challenges: Set clear time limits to see how they perform under realistic pressure. This also helps you understand their problem-solving speed and approach.
  • Code Quality and Documentation: Encourage candidates to write clean, readable code with proper documentation. This practice not only covers their technical skill but also their preparedness for collaboration and maintainability of the codebase.

By integrating practical coding tests into your hiring process, you can directly evaluate whether the candidate possesses the necessary skills to solve actual project problems.
